

In response to the campus context and program, the building layers itself from a traditional brick mass on the north to a contemporary transparent wall of glass on the south.


The campus has more than 12,000 full-time undergraduate students.Īn aging residence hall was demolished to make way for the new recreation center, which has a jogging track, group exercise studios, rock-climbing wall, racquetball courts, multi-activity gymnasium and a cafe/juice bar.

start.The new Student Recreation Center at West Chester University (WCU), one of the top regional public universities in the country, boasts more than 71,000 square feet of carefully designed recreation and social space for the campus community.
